France Ski Resorts

In the French Alps, the most famous ski venue is Chamonix-Mont-Blanc, though skiing is by no means the only attraction. Chamonix is the oldest and biggest French winter-sports resort and site of the first Winter Olympics, held in 1924. The Bastille, France, The Start of the Revolution

The Bastille has long been an important figure in Frances history. Built as a fortress during the hundred year war, it has switched colors frequently and served as a castle, a treasury, and lastly a prison.
